Course structure

• Introduction to Risk Management
• Legal and Regulatory Framework
• Risk Assessment and Analysis
• Risk Mitigation Strategies
• Crisis Management
• Insurance and Claims Management
• Business Continuity Planning
• Risk Reporting and Communication
• Risk Management in Educational Projects
• Emerging Risks in Education Sector

Career path

Career Roles Key Responsibilities
Education Risk Manager Develop and implement risk management strategies in educational institutions.
Compliance Officer Ensure educational policies and procedures comply with regulations and standards.
Emergency Preparedness Coordinator Create and maintain emergency response plans for educational facilities.
Health and Safety Specialist Identify and mitigate health and safety risks in educational settings.
Insurance Claims Analyst Assess and process insurance claims related to educational risks.
Training and Development Manager Provide risk management training to staff and faculty members.
